Senior CRM & Reporting Analyst
Help Build the Future of Philanthropy
Technology is transforming how nonprofits build relationships, engage donors, and strengthen communities. At The Associated, we're investing in a modern Salesforce platform to power our mission—and we're looking for someone who wants to help shape what comes next.
We're seeking a Senior CRM & Reporting Analyst who enjoys solving problems, working with data, and partnering with colleagues to make technology easier and more impactful. This is more than a reporting role—it's an opportunity to help design better business processes, improve user experiences, and enable smarter decision-making across the organization.
If you enjoy combining technology, analytics, and collaboration to create meaningful change, we'd love to meet you.
This is a full-time, hybrid position that requires a minimum of three days per week in the office.
What You'll Do
You'll become a trusted Salesforce resource for departments across The Associated by:
- Supporting and enhancing our Salesforce Nonprofit Cloud CRM and Salesforce Marketing Cloud
- Creating reports and dashboards that turn data into meaningful insights
- Troubleshooting user questions and resolving CRM issues
- Developing documentation and delivering engaging user training
- Supporting change management and helping colleagues adopt new technology
- Participating in CRM enhancements, testing, and future system improvements
- Championing data quality and CRM best practices
We're looking for someone who is naturally curious, enjoys learning new technology, and loves helping people succeed.
Ideal candidates will have:
- Bachelor's degree in a related field
- Three or more years of CRM, database, or business systems experience
- Experience with Salesforce (Nonprofit Cloud experience is a plus)
- Strong reporting and analytical skills
- Experience creating dashboards and reports
- Excellent communication and training skills
- Strong problem-solving abilities and attention to detail
- A collaborative approach and commitment to outstanding customer service
Experience with any of the following is a plus:
- Nonprofit fundraising or donor databases
- Change management or user adoption initiatives
- Excel, Power BI and/or other business intelligence tools
- Data imports, data quality, or CRM implementations
You'll join a collaborative team that's reimagining how technology supports fundraising, engagement, and community impact. Your ideas will matter, your work will be visible, and you'll have opportunities to grow alongside an amazing nonprofit technology transformation.
If you enjoy solving puzzles, improving processes, and helping people use technology more effectively, you'll thrive here.
Compensation & Benefits:
Salary range is $69,000-$73,000 and is commensurate with qualifications, skills, and experience
Application Process – Electronic submissions are preferred. Cover letters are required.
Benefit & Perks: The Associated offers a comprehensive benefits package, including health insurance (Health Savings Account), 4% 401(k) employer match, life insurance, Long Term Disability (LTD), Flexible Spending Plan, paid parental leave, holiday pay, tuition reimbursement, wellbeing programming, and a complimentary membership to the Jewish Community Center.
